PET Bottle Washing Line: A Complete Overview

Wiki Article

A modern PET plastic washing process is vital for producing high-quality rPET PET flakes . This thorough guide explains the various stages involved, from first sorting and rough cleaning to complete sanitization . The operation typically includes a number of stages like reducing, sorting , heated washing, cool rinsing, and dewatering . Understanding each aspect is important for optimizing efficiency and verifying the cleanliness of the end product, ultimately benefiting the reuse market.

Boosting Efficiency: Pelletizing Machines for Plastic Recycling

Waste plastic reuse efforts are increasingly benefiting plastic film washing line from the adoption of pelletizing systems . These modern devices transform granulated materials into standardized pellets, ideal for further manufacturing applications . Pelletizing boosts material management , minimizes inconsistencies, and finally increases the overall output of the repurposing facility .

The Role of Polymer Shredders in Scrap Management

Polymer shredders are taking an progressively critical role in modern scrap management systems . These machines reduce large polymer items into reduced fragments , allowing them ready for recycling or further treatment. This technique not only minimizes the volume of polymer waste sent to disposal sites, but too contributes to retrieve reusable materials out of used plastic products . Ultimately , plastic shredders are vital tools in creating a more responsible garbage management infrastructure .

Plastic Film Washing Lines: Cleaning for a Circular Economy

Synthetic sheeting cleaning facilities are proving vital parts in advancing a circular system. These dedicated operations eliminate impurities , like labels and food waste , from recycled polymer film . The comprehensive sanitization allows improved remanufactured material to function as a valuable resource for alternative goods, reducing our reliance on newly produced synthetics and supporting a environmentally friendly landscape.

Optimizing Your Waste Procedure: Integrating Key Polymer Equipment

To boost performance and diminish overhead in your recycling plant, evaluate integrating specialized plastic machinery. This features solutions like automated sorting systems, which accurately separate distinct plastic categories , and densifiers that compress materials for more convenient transportation . Furthermore, investing in advanced shredders or granulators permits for the creation of high-quality plastic regrind, acceptable for remanufacturing , ultimately adding to a more sustainable and lucrative recycling business .

From Scraps to Asset : A Review at PET Packaging & Pelletizing Solutions

The escalating problem of plastic refuse demands innovative techniques. One promising answer involves transforming post-consumer plastic film into valuable granules . This re-processing process typically begins with categorizing the film , followed by purifying and grinding . The resultant substance is then fused and extruded into small, uniform pellets , ready to be used in the creation of new items , effectively closing the loop and minimizing environmental impact . This change from scrap to a usable commodity represents a significant step toward a more responsible future.
